HARDYS HRB CABERNET SAUVIGNON
Hardys HRB Cabernet Sauvignon 2017
A concentrated and richly textured with layers of dark berry fruit flavours, cassis, green and dark chocolate. Notes of peppercorn, bay leaf, mint and sweet spice contribute to the complexity.
VARIETIES: Cabernet Sauvignon, 20 to 70 years
REGION: Margaret River, Coonawarra, Frankland River & McLaren Vale
AGEING: 100% French, 25% new oak for 16 months as individual vineyard components
GUARDING POTENTIAL: 10 years ±
SERVE: Serve at 16 – 18ºC

HRB | Range | Hardys
Our Heritage Reserve Bin wines push the boundaries of winemaking through cross-regional blending of hand-selected grapes. Only the premier Australian regions for each varietal are considered for inclusion each vintage. The result is a complex, unique expression of the varietal, that retains the finest character of each terroir.
